概括
聚合物支持的プロ林-氨酸二化物作为阿尔多尔反应的有效器官催化剂. 两类区块共聚合物表现出高转化率和酶选择性,即使经过多次回收循环.

主要成果:
- 成功合成了水友和两友块共聚物.
- 两性聚合物 (1c) 在DMF/水混合物中形成自组合聚合物.
- 聚合物1c在阿尔多尔反应中表现出优越的催化活性.
- 高转换率 (95%) 和反选择性 (94%) 在低负荷 (5%) 时获得1c.
- 催化剂1c表现出极好的可回收性.
结论:
- 烯-氨酸二聚部分在两块共聚合物中是有效的有机催化剂.
- 聚合物的两性质和自我组装有助于增强催化活性.
- 这些聚合物支持的催化剂为阿尔多尔反应提供了可持续和高效的方法.

[4+2] Cycloaddition of Conjugated Dienes: Diels–Alder Reaction
10.1K
The Diels–Alder reaction is an example of a thermal pericyclic reaction between a conjugated diene and an alkene or alkyne, commonly referred to as a dienophile. The reaction involves a concerted movement of six π electrons, four from the diene and two from the dienophile, forming an unsaturated six-membered ring. As a result, these reactions are classified as [4+2] cycloadditions.
